four 4" aeros will give u 50.24sq" or port area...(pi*r^2*4(for four ports))

depending on how long they are will get u displacement...

example: one 4"aero 10" long

1 4"aero=12.56sq" of area (again pi*r^2)

then just multiply 12.56*10=125.6cubic"

so 125.6 * 4 (again, for 4 ports)=502.4cubic"

502.4/1728= .2907cft of displacement

might just be a shade more because of the flares, but that is probably really insignificant

hope that helped...basically just area * length
